The treaty patch is a two sided issue:
One the one hand, the patch shouldn't be released before most things are balanced as far as possible (which is a hard thing to decide, when is it ready for publication/ when is it still not?). Because if there come later updates to the patch, many players will be on different versions of the patch, and for example old recs one an old version of the patch would be lost etc. This is imo the worst case scenario, as it results in total chaos and a bad reputation for any future patches.
On the other hand, not
Publishing the patch in the near future might end up in an angry community, as they're excluded from the few invited players. This is development might be supported by this stream event, where all the excluded players will see the few, exclusively unveiled ones having fun on their patch. So this could again cause the patch to appear in a bad light.
Anyways, it's a great thing that there is another official treaty event that may contribute to the rise of treaty in popularity ! I look forward to watching it, and I hope the 4 candidates will not isolate themselves with their patch.

Every invited player to this invitational has been part of the process of developing the Treaty Fanpatch. Three of the players are some of the primary contributors to our design/balance discussions, and all four have played multiple games on the TR Fanpatch.
Opening up the patch to the general population without a launcher and easy distribution method for future changes is not something we want to do, so we are going to use this invitational as a way to showcase some of the major changes in advance of the official release.
We are currently planning for an initial release relatively soon, but we do not intend to until after we can either integrate into the ESOC launcher or build our own.
